Windows 11 significantly promotes logging in with a Microsoft account during installation, impacting users who prioritize privacy over convenience. A local account, stored solely on the device, prevents data from being sent to the cloud and eliminates issues like unwanted access for others. While initially challenging, users can utilize specific workarounds to create a local account or switch from a Microsoft account to a local one, ensuring greater control over personal data and preferences during the installation process.
